Bring Me Back: A Novel by B. A. Paris: Conversation Starters

Ten years ago, Layla and Finn went on vacation. During a stop at a service station, Layla went missing, never to be seen again. Now, Finn is engaged to her sister, Ellen. They came close because of their shared pain over Layla’s disappearance and now they want to be together. But Finn suspects there is more to Ellen that what meets the eye, and, after he starts receiving strange messages from people who claim to have seen Layla alive, he starts to question everything.
“Bring Me Back” is a suspense thriller written by B. A. Paris, bestselling author of “The Breakdown” and “Behind Closed Doors”. It was described as an exceptional Hitchcockian novel by Publishers Weekly.
